LG Boss To Give Courts Facelift
The Chairman of Emohua Local Government Area, Dr Chidi Lloyd has marked the Magistrate Court and the Customary Court in the Local Government Area for immediate intervention.
The Council Chairman stated this during a facility tour of the Magistrate Court and the Customary Court in Rumuji Town in Emohua Local Government Area.
He frowned at the deplorable condition of the only courts in the Local Government Area.
Lloyd promised to initiate intervention projects to improve the condition of the two courts, in order to ensure quick dispensation of Justice in the area.
The Chief magistrate of Emohua Magisterial District, Chief Magistrate Lenu Baridam who conducted the council chairman round the facilities at the court premises said the poor condition of the Magistrate Court in the Local Government Area had been a source of worry to the staff and practitioners in the Magisterial District and appealed for the intervention of the council chairman.
Earlier, the Chairman of Rumuji Customary Court, Barr Friday Ugwu who congratulated the council chairman on his laudable projects in Emohua Local Government Area said the visit of the council chairman to the Customary Court had rekindled the hope for a better working environment on the staff of the court.
The Council chairman was accompanied by his deputy, Hon Edna Nyeche, the leader of Emohua Legislative Council, Hon Love Nyenke, former Caretaker Committee Chairman of Emohua LGA, Chief Azundah Nkomadu and other principal officers of the Local Government Council.
